ROI, drawdown, win rate, profit factor and trade counts for MQL5 listings are FxRobotEasy modelled Strategy Tester aggregates — simulated, not live or broker-verified. Rating, price and downloads come from the MQL5 Market listing. The FxRobotEasy column is different in kind: those rows are one published trading account, read live from app.fxroboteasy.com at page build, not a modelled run. It is not like-for-like with the columns beside it, and the per-row winner marker compares a live account against simulations. Its rating and downloads are not tracked here.

Begin with a demo account under the same broker conditions you plan to use live to observe spreads, slippage, and execution. Run the EA over several market regimes and at least a few weeks to evaluate drawdown patterns. Use conservative lot sizing and document results. Request any available backtests, live demos, or logs from the vendor. Remember that no historical or demo result guarantees future performance; manage risk with stops, diversification, and position sizing.
